Fiona Rotherham

Fiona Rotherham has rejoined in March 2024 for a third time at NBR, as a senior journalist. She has been a journalist for over 40 years, focused mainly on business. Her most recent role prior to rejoining NBR was as editor of startup Caffeine which was focused on startup founders. Fiona’s other previous roles include co-editor at NBR, head of Stuff business nationally, editor of The Independent business weekly and Unlimited magazine which focused on entrepreneurs.
